YouthBank Tower Hamlets
We regret to announce that YouthBank Tower Hamlets will be closing from 31 July 2010.
YouthBank Tower Hamlets (YBTH) is a grant-making project for young people run by young people, aged 14-24. A committee of young grant-makers, from the same age range as the applicants, operate under the main board of the Trust. The panel members oversee all grant-making and award grants for charitable purposes.
Funding Factories
YBTH deliver a project called Funding Factory for free to youth groups within the borough of Tower Hamlets. It is a ten hour training course that is accredited as a level two qualification by the National Open College Network (NOCN). This project has been commissioned to YBTH to carry out on behalf of the London Borough of Tower Hamlets.

Groups must be formed by six to twelve young people who are aged between 14-21 years. The programme is usually split into 5 x 2.5 hours evening sessions and based at the youth groups venue. Groups need to be supervised by a youth worker during each session as YBTH will not be held responsible for any problems that may occur. Completion of the course will be rewarded by Certificates of Participation and NOCN Certificates will only be awarded to those who fulfil the criteria of the course.
